Hi all,

I'm a designer and newbie to restylegc, so my apologies for having
little idea what I'm doing! I am trying to create a page with a left
column containing a variable amount of text and a right column
containing a Google calendar in agenda view. What I would like to do
is make it possible for the calendar to expand/contract with the text
so that the two columns are always the same height. I've been working
with dojo to manipulate the Google calendar DOM, but I haven't had any
luck. I will also be using restylegc to modify the CSS; that I'm
relatively comfortable with.

So far, I've tried using dojo.query, dojo.create, and dojo.attr in the
retylegc.pho document to edit the existing nodes but I have been
unable to even get the changes to appear (i.e., if I try to add a div,
it doesn't show up in the HTML). I'm wondering if I'm even starting in
the right place.

If anyone has done this before, or has any suggestions, I would
greatly appreciate the help. Let me know if it would be useful to see
my HTML or the HTML for the Google calendar.

1) Download the latest version of RESTYLEgc. It uses jQuery instead
of Dojo.

2) The calendar already stretches to 100% height of its container,
namely the iframe. Skip the JavaScript and try setting the iframe
height to 100% of its container with a combination of the height
attribute and CSS.
